142H. The aforesaid fees of said constables and justices for

 

said county shall be taxed against and paid by the party

How the fees
are to be

against whom judgment shall be rendered, unless he or she

collected.

be discharged therefrom by clue course of law ; if such party

 

against whom judgment is rendered is unable to pay the

 

same, such fees shall be paid by said County Commissioners

 

subject to the limitation set forth in Sections I42F and 1420.
